Student Population

North Carolina A&T State University educates a diverse community of 14,933 students, with 13,017 pursuing undergraduate degrees and 1,916 engaged in advanced graduate studies.

Admissions

The admission process at North Carolina A&T State University has a 46% acceptance rate. The cost to apply is $60. North Carolina A&T State University has test required that focus on each student's unique potential. The average SAT score is 1080 and the average ACT score is 18.

Cost

North Carolina A&T State University makes education accessible, offering an average net price of $10,258 with 96% of students receiving financial assistance including 51% benefiting from Pell Grants.
